Overview
- Lead Spend Control Tower activities
- Identify, lead and develop Continuous Improvement and Stakeholder Management initiatives to achieve maximum efficiency and productivity in Procurement
Continuous improvement
- Take responsibility for productivity/ cost efficiency targets and key compliance metrics (e.g. process compliance; internal audits)
- Manage quality and CI of end-to-end Procurement process, including compliance to policies, strategies and processes
Spend control tower (SCT)
- Prepare materials, contracts and change requests for SCT meetings
- Execute decisions made during meetings
- Maintain governance processes of the SCT
Stakeholder management
- Create strategic category plans to develop long-term supplier relationships that will provide consistent benefits for the organisation
- Lead and build effective relationships with key suppliers to drive value for Aspen through cost effectiveness and innovation
- Drive implementation of supplier strategies
- Manage foreign and local supplier landscape in line with business strategies and global Procurement goals and strategies
- Optimise the supply base through consolidation and leverages and negotiates pricing on combined volumes with industry leading suppliers to reduce the cost of goods and overheads
- Increase spend under contract and negotiates supply agreements with vendors, improving commercial conditions
Risk management
- Set up effective processes to ensure optimum risk assessment, feasibility assessment and planning are implemented
- Manage the legal/ economic implications of Procurement activities
- Assess and mitigate risks associated with Procurement function
- Perform supplier risk assessment and develop mitigation plans
Unit management
- Provide technical and operational input during drafting of unit strategy and operational objectives
- Guide operational planning and advise on prioritisation of activities
- Provide input into budgets and resource requirements for unit
- Request and allocate assets and resources for the fulfilment of work objectives and monitor their use
- Provide unit staff with day-to-day direction and tasks
- Ensure effective communication between the different Procurement functions and report on Procurement activities as required
Requirements
Background/experience
- 10 years’ relevant experience in a production planning or procurement role
- At least three years in a pharmaceutical manufacturing environment
- Proven capability to manage people and processes
- Bachelor’s degree in Finance, Supply Chain Management, or a similar field
Specific Job Skills
- Thorough knowledge of Pharmaceutical manufacturing processes and operations environment
- Demonstrated managerial capability
